< prev index next >
src/java.base/share/classes/sun/security/x509/AlgorithmId.java
Print this page
@@ -569,11 +569,11 @@
if (index == alias.length()) {
// invalid alias entry
break;
}
if (oidTable == null) {
- oidTable = new HashMap<String,ObjectIdentifier>();
+ oidTable = new HashMap<>();
}
oidString = alias.substring(index);
String stdAlgName = provs[i].getProperty(alias);
if (stdAlgName != null) {
stdAlgName = stdAlgName.toUpperCase(Locale.ENGLISH);
@@ -586,11 +586,11 @@
}
}
}
if (oidTable == null) {
- oidTable = new HashMap<String,ObjectIdentifier>(1);
+ oidTable = new HashMap<>(1);
}
initOidTable = true;
}
return oidTable.get(name.toUpperCase(Locale.ENGLISH));
@@ -885,11 +885,11 @@
* SHA1 digest is signed using the Digital Signing Algorithm (DSA).
* OID = 1.2.840.10040.4.3
*/
sha1WithDSA_oid = ObjectIdentifier.newInternal(dsaWithSHA1_PKIX_data);
- nameTable = new HashMap<ObjectIdentifier,String>();
+ nameTable = new HashMap<>();
nameTable.put(MD5_oid, "MD5");
nameTable.put(MD2_oid, "MD2");
nameTable.put(SHA_oid, "SHA-1");
nameTable.put(SHA224_oid, "SHA-224");
nameTable.put(SHA256_oid, "SHA-256");
< prev index next >